WORKSHOP re: Jefferson County Public Utility District (PUD) No. 1 Request to Purchase County property for the Installation of an Electrical Substation: County Administrator Mark McCauley and Jefferson County Public Utilities District No. 1 (PUD) Manager Kevin Street provided a presentation to request that the county consider selling two parcels so that the PUD can build an EV charging station and improve their electrical grid. PUD Manager Street shared options of building a new station or expand an existing location, and answered questions posed by the Board. After the presentation, Commissioner Brotherton moved to authorize County Administrator McCauley to negotiate with PUD to find a workable solution to selling parcels 001161001 and part of 001162002. Commissioner Eisenhour seconded the motion. Chair Dean opened the floor for public comment. No comments were received. The motion carried by a unanimous vote.
